What is a Graduation Rate?

The graduation rate is a measure of the percentage of students who complete their degree within a specified timeframe. It is calculated by dividing the number of students who graduate within the prescribed time by the total number of students enrolled in the program.

A high graduation rate indicates that a college provides the necessary support and resources for its students to succeed academically and complete their degree on time. On the other hand, a low graduation rate may indicate that students face challenges or barriers that prevent them from completing their degree.

When considering the graduation rate of a college, it is important to look at the specific timeframe used for calculation. Some colleges may use a four-year graduation rate, while others may use a six-year graduation rate. This difference is important to consider, as it can impact the overall graduation rate of the college.

The History and Myth of Graduation Rate

The concept of graduation rate has been around for many years, but its significance has become more prominent in recent times. In the past, graduation rates were not widely discussed or used as a measure of college quality. However, with increasing competition among colleges and a focus on student success, graduation rates have gained attention as an important metric.

There is a common myth that colleges with high graduation rates are "easy" or "less challenging" compared to those with lower graduation rates. However, this is not necessarily true. A high graduation rate indicates that a college provides the necessary support and resources for its students to succeed academically. It does not imply that the coursework or academic standards are less rigorous.

It is important to remember that each student's experience is different, and factors such as personal motivation, time management, and external circumstances can impact their ability to complete their degree. A high graduation rate simply indicates that a college has implemented effective support systems to help students overcome challenges and stay on track.
